What would need to happen for Shiba Inu to reach $1?
For Shiba Inu to reach $1, the cryptocurrency would need a market capitalization of approximately $590 trillion, which exceeds the total value of all global wealth combined. The meme coin currently has a circulating supply of nearly 590 trillion tokens, meaning each coin represents a tiny fraction of value. To achieve this price point, extraordinary catalysts would need to materialize, including massive token burns reducing supply, unprecedented adoption driving demand, and sustained bull market conditions lasting years.
Additionally, Shiba Inu would need to become widely accepted as a legitimate payment method, establish real-world utility through its Shibarium layer-2 blockchain, and attract institutional investment typically reserved for more established cryptocurrencies.
Why is $1 considered unlikely for Shiba Inu right now?
The $1 price target is considered highly unlikely because achieving it would require Shiba Inu to gain value by a factor of approximately 285,000 from current levels. For context, Bitcoin took over a decade to grow from fractions of a cent to tens of thousands of dollars, and it has a much smaller total supply. The fundamental challenge lies in Shiba Inu's massive token supply, which makes each individual coin inherently inexpensive and creates mathematical barriers to reaching dollar-level prices.
Market analysts and financial experts widely agree that while meme coins can experience dramatic short-term price swings driven by social media hype and celebrity endorsements, sustaining such astronomical gains would require completely unprecedented market conditions.

How does Shiba Inu's token supply compare to other major cryptocurrencies?
Shiba Inu's token supply of approximately 590 trillion coins stands in stark contrast to major c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in, which has a maximum supply of just 21 million coins. This enormous supply difference explains why Shiba Inu trades for fractions of a cent while Bitcoin trades for tens of thousands of dollars. For comparison, if Bitcoin had Shiba Inu's supply structure, a single Bitcoin would be worth far less than a penny.
The meme coin has also permanently removed substantial token quantities from circulation by sending them to Vitalik Buterin's wallet, which were effectively burned. However, even with significant burn efforts, the remaining supply remains massive compared to traditional cryptocurrencies.
